All the Boys Love Mandy Lane (2006)
A Decent Plot, But Confusing Ending (Very Minor Spoilers)
The title of this review might seem confusing but stick around and read some more, and you will know what I mean.
"All the Boys Love Mandy Lane" has an interesting plot when it comes to horror films, but the plot does not make up for the lack of interest I had for the characters.
The main characters are like your average group of cliche teenage jerks that can be found in an array of horror movies. The drink, they do drugs, they make smart-a** remarks; UGH. The originality is missing! Although Mandy is not necessarily like the others when it comes to this aspect, her overall cold and uninterested aura can leave the viewer feeling the same way- uninterested.
As said before, the plot is fairly interesting, and the continuity in the film makes sense; except for the last 5 minutes of the film. The filmmakers tease you with what seems to be an ending, just to pull a total 180 and add a twist that was highly unnecessary. If they wanted to leave some members of the audience confused, then a job well done to them.
When it comes down to it, I would recommend this film to people who LOVE slasher films. If you are a viewer who can tolerate slasher films, but you're not a HUGE fan of them (such as me) you might want to skip out on this one.
Communion (1976)
An Interesting Twist on the Slasher Franchise
"Alice, Sweet Alice" is a fresh story amidst the other slashers that came out in the '70s and early '80s.
Instead of making a story that revolves around an older, crazy man whose bloodthirst sends him on a rampage of murder, "Alice, Sweet Alice" involves mystery and murder where the death of a young girl has a small town suspicious, because all the evidence points to the deceased girl's sister, Alice, as being the killer.
Check this movie out. If you're a fan of slashers that aren't just about blood and gore, this movie will certainly whet your appetite!

My Bloody Valentine (2009)
My Bloody EYES
This is the one of the worst....WORST... horror films I've ever seen. Spoof films like "The Gingerdead Man" are more excusable than this piece of trash.
I am honestly quite surprised that so many people enjoyed this film. As a person that regularly watches horror movies, I found this film not only to be a major waste of time, but an unintentional spoof of slasher films in general.
The kills in this film can be seen from a mile away. It was to the point where I was predicting what was going to happen about 5-6 minutes before it happened. The kills are simply there for the sake of 3D. In other words, they're stupid and could be described as gore for the sake of gore- even for a slasher film.
I would rather watch the lackluster Friday the 13th 2009 remake 1,000 times before ever watching this film again.
If you are intrigued by the story, do yourself a favor and go watch the original. You will save yourself a lot of time.
